Buffalo State led by 12 points late in the opening half, but the Hawks closed the frame with a 7-0 run, ending the period trailing, 36-31. The Bengals pulled away early in the second half, reestablishing a 12-point lead, but the Hawks battled back again, closing the deficit to a single point in the waning moments. Buffalo State never relinquished the lead, however, and held on for the victory.
Gregg Jones (Syracuse/Nottingham) led Buffalo State with a game-high 20 points. Dion Mozelle (Rego Park/Xaverian) and Dante Griggs (Bronx/Chester Academy) each added double-doubles for Buffalo State. Mozelle scored 14 points and grabbed 15 rebounds, and Griggs had 14 points and 11 boards.
Bobby Kaible (Saugerties/Saugerties) led New Paltz with 17 points. John Hauser (East Williston/Chaminade) added 11 points, seven rebounds and five assists.
